Accurate Problem Detection
European vehicles come with complex systems, and each has numerous sensors that monitor the engine, transmission, brakes, and countless components. A proper diagnostic scan will allow the mechanic to identify specific error codes and show them where the issue originated. It permits the mechanic to address the appropriate problem on the first visit. For example, a check engine light can be caused by dozens of causes, from a loose gas cap to a severe engine failure. Diagnostics eliminate wasted time from parts that did not need replacing or repairs that were done incorrectly.

Prevents Further Damage
Ignoring the minimal signals of trouble or skipping diagnostics can lead to bigger issues down the road. European vehicles are precision machines; minimal issues can turn into large catastrophes. For example, a misfire that is undiagnosed could do damage to your catalytic converter, which is a repair that costs thousands of dollars when it comes time to replace it. A diagnostic test will allow the shop to identify minor faults to avoid massive faults—think of it like your car's annual health checkup! Ensures Specialized Care
European vehicles operate differently than domestic vehicles. Frequently, European vehicles require specific diagnostic equipment and software to read the unique fault code and data stream. Basic scanners may misread or miss the data stream, or signature signals could lead to a missed diagnosis. European-certified diagnostic scanners are made with the necessary equipment to diagnose a European vehicle's computer and electronic systems.
